The Hi-Fi+ review positions the Kronos Discovery as more than an extension of the Kronos Pro. It presents Discovery as a complete ground-up statement design, focused on reducing the mechanical and sonic signatures normally associated with vinyl playback.
The review emphasizes how Discovery appears to step through surface noise, allowing the music itself to remain central. Instead of drawing attention to a particular tonal character, the turntable is described as unusually transparent and direct.
